Forge Hub Rank System


Member Ranks

Each rank has 5 progressions,
requiring a set amount of posts to move to the next. For example, a UNSC Trainee Grade 1 requires 25 posts, Grade 2 requires 30 posts and so on, increasing every 5 posts until the next rank is reached at 50 posts.

As you increase in rank, the number of posts required to progress also increases. For example, an Askar requires 40 posts to move between grades, and 200 posts to move to the next rank.

The central blue bar in each rank tracks your overall progress, and increases for each grade you gain. It's a quick way to see which ranks are higher than others if you don't know the order by their names, and ties the ranks together in a consistent way.




















Prestige Ranks

Premium
This rank is awarded to members who have had 2 or more maps featured on the front page of Forge Hub. For each additional feature, they gain an extra bar in their rank.



Architect
This rank is awarded to members who have had 7 or more maps featured on the front page of Forge Hub.



Loyal
This rank is awarded to members who have contributed consistently to the site and/or the community.



Consideration for Loyal
Members that:
  • follow the forum rules
  • post well informed replies/topics
  • are helpful to other forum members
  • are kind to others
  • put effort into making members feel welcome
  • have been a long standing member
  • do NOT ask for the rank
are privately considered for the rank.

Respected
This rank is awarded to members who are widely known throughout the Halo community as a whole.



Affiliate
This rank is awarded to members who administrate one of our affiliate sites.




Staff Ranks

Tech Admin
Maintains and manages the technical requirements of the site.



Administrator
Administrates the site and manages the staff.



Moderator
Moderates the site and maintains a consistent service for members.



Journalist
Writes front page articles for the site and moderates where necessary.



Guardian
Temporary moderation staff drawn from the Loyal rank.




Restricted Ranks

Warned
Automatically assigned usergroup that restricts forum access and privileges based on current infractions. Incremented in 3 successive levels.



Banned
Automatically assigned usergroup that prevents forum access based on current infractions.




Notes

Any unusual user titles you might see are custom, which have either been chosen by the user themselves, or won in a site competition. These aren't official ranks... but they are pretty damn cool.

Please note that an individual's post count does not matter here at Forge Hub and we do not condone spamming. This list is simply for people who are interested in our user rank system.

Timezones

Original Thread

Here's a list of all of the time zones relative to GMT (Greenwich Mean Time).

Hopefully it'll help with planning and doing certain events with players from across the globe - without the nonsense of having to go to another site to find the infomation.


Name Description Relative to GMT
GMTGreenwich Mean TimeGMT + 0:00
UTCUniversal Coordinated TimeGMT + 0:00
BSTBritish Summer TimeGMT + 1:00
ECTEuropean Central TimeGMT + 1:00
EETEastern European TimeGMT + 2:00
ART(Arabic) Egypt Standard TimeGMT + 2:00
EATEastern African TimeGMT + 3:00
METMiddle East TimeGMT + 3:30
NETNear East TimeGMT + 4:00
PLTPakistan Lahore TimeGMT + 5:00
ISTIndia Standard TimeGMT + 5:30
BSTBangladesh Standard TimeGMT + 6:00
VSTVietnam Standard TimeGMT + 7:00
CTTChina Taiwan TimeGMT + 8:00
JSTJapan Standard TimeGMT + 9:00
ACTAustralia Central TimeGMT + 9:30
AETAustralia Eastern TimeGMT + 10:00
SSTSolomon Standard TimeGMT + 11:00
NSTNew Zealand Standard TimeGMT + 12:00
MITMidway Islands TimeGMT - 11:00
HSTHawaii Standard TimeGMT - 10:00
ASTAlaska Standard TimeGMT - 9:00
PSTPacific Standard TimeGMT - 8:00
PNTPhoenix Standard TimeGMT - 7:00
MSTMountain Standard TimeGMT - 7:00
CSTCentral Standard TimeGMT - 6:00
ESTEastern Standard TimeGMT - 5:00
IETIndiana Eastern Standard TimeGMT - 5:00
PRTPuerto Rico and US Virgin Islands TimeGMT - 4:00
CNTCanada Newfoundland TimeGMT - 3:30
AGTArgentina Standard TimeGMT - 3:00
BETBrazil Eastern TimeGMT - 3:00
CATCentral African TimeGMT - 1:00




Daylight Saving:

For the countries in blue in this map, daylight saving is used. This means that in Summer Time, the clocks are put forward 1 hour in response to it getting darker earlier in the day.

This would mean that in Summer Time, your area would be an extra 1:00 ahead of what it would normally be.


Approximately 70 countries utilize Daylight Saving Time in at least one portion of the country. They all save one hour in the summer and change their clocks some time between midnight and 3:00 a.m.

New members who can't post or reply

There have been a few questions from newly registered members who are unable to post threads, reply to threads, or basically do anything apart from view a couple of things around the forums.

Generally this is because the email validation has not been carried out by this user. When you first register on Forge Hub, you are automatically sent an activation email to the email address you entered when you signed up. In some cases, this email is not sent, in others, users simply don't realise that they must check this email and click the activation link to enable posting etc. on their account.

If you are experiencing this problem, please check your emails at the email address you entered upon registration, and click the link contained within the activation email. If you haven't received this email, please copy and paste the following in to the address bar on your browser, then type the email address you registered with to resend the activation email:
